Shade Palettes That Celebrate the Past
Shade plays a massive duty in setting the tone for vintage-inspired interiors. Natural tones such as olive eco-friendly, terracotta, mustard yellow, and messy rose are having a major minute. These shades are evocative the seventies however have actually been upgraded with a soft, desaturated twist that feels entirely existing.
Paired with luscious whites, cozy timbers, and pops of matte black, these shades create depth and calmness. They're not just stylish-- they're relaxing. Whether on the wall surfaces, through textiles, or in accent design, these tones aid bridge the gap in between vintage influence and contemporary perceptiveness.

The Importance of Texture and Layering
Vintage-inspired insides depend greatly on structure to produce visual rate of interest. Rough-hewn wood, nubby materials, smooth leather, and matte ceramics come together to create a room that welcomes touch. In contemporary homes that commonly lean minimal, this tactile richness brings back the human component.
Layering is additionally crucial. Toss blankets, area rugs, woven baskets, and classic publications or records placed purposefully around a space all contribute to the feeling of heat. It's not regarding clutter-- it's concerning curated coziness. When done right, the space really feels lived-in, yet advanced.
